- "' Internal colonialism "'is a notion of structural political and economic inequalities between regions within a nation state.
- The first known use of the concept'internal colonialism'was in 1957, in a book by Leo Marquard, regarding South Africa.
- Gonzalez Casanova was both critiqued by, and influenced Andre Gunder Frank, who further theorised internal colonialism as a form of " uneven development ".
